A late-Victorian novelty silver cracker pin cushion and sewing box,
by Gibson and Langman, London 1898, also marked with a registration number,
the ends of the cracker with worn velvet pin cushions, the central section with a hinged compartment, the cover mounted with a lady with a flute and a gentleman with a trumpet, length 16.8cm, approx. weight 3.4oz.
